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04239 6820172 20953787 646242764
73042557204 5809 96496
73042557204 5809 96496
00942942158 9743838383 7837
All about undefined
Interested in learning more?
73042557204 5809 96496
00942942158 9743838383 7837
See more
80791667 3016
8823777 703 1140
See more
440365298 2325178
25358900 7064181983 3628476 75
See more